Monte Albano
Monte Albano is a peak in Casola Valsenio, Ravenna, Emilia-Romagna and has an elevation of 475 metres. Monte Albano is situated nearby to the locality Battole, as well as near Case Poggio.Places of Interest

Sant’Eufemia
Hamlet
Sant'Eufemia is a Roman Catholic church located on Via Barbiani in Ravenna, region of Emilia Romagna, Italy. The church was designed by Giovan Francesco Buonamici, and erected between 1742 and 1747 upon the foundations of a palaeo-Christian temple.
